Champion Counterpart, Trained by Gegard Mousasi, Mocks Israel Adesanya As ‘Easiest Fight’; Claims He Can ‘Choke’ the UFC Middleweight King

The reigning UFC middleweight champion Israel Adesanya is considered as one of the magnificent fighters in recent times. Adesanya has broken many records in the UFC. In fact, he holds the second-longest winning streak in UFC middleweight history. Also, he is known as one of the best strikers in the MMA world and has been undefeated at middleweight in the UFC.
Recently, in the ONE Championship, double champion Reinier de Ridder took a dig at Adesanya and said he was ‘an easy’ fight for him. Reinier de Ridder is the reigning middleweight and light heavyweight champion at ONE Championship. The double champion spoke to MMA Junkie and thrashed Adesanya’s fighting style.

He said, “I know I can hang with the best of them. If I look at like Israel Adesanya, the way he moves, his style, it’s like tailor-made for me. That guy is the easiest fight for me at middleweight around at the top. The way he moves, he’s so easy to be taken down in the open space. His wrestling defense against the wall is amazing. He gets up well. He defends all right on the floor. But I think I can choke that guy out easily.”
However, De Ridder is currently fighting at ONE championship. But he will soon be open for a change. Further, the fighter did not rule out fighting in the UFC soon once he goes into free agency. Nevertheless, he could be trouble for the UFC’s middleweight champion if he does come over to the UFC. He claims to have understood his standing among the best fighters in the world after training with the Bellator middleweight champ Gegard Mousasi.

Israel Adesanya recalls his weirdest fight in the UFC

The middleweight king is known for his exciting fighting style and has given fans some brilliant performances in the octagon. In an interview with renowned MMA reporter Ariel Helwani and spoke about his weirdest fight in the UFC.
Adesanya said his fight against Yoel Romero was ‘weird’ and called the fight boring. He said, “hundred percent. the weirdest fight I’ve ever been a part of. Even for me as a fan the most boring fight I’ve ever had.”

Moreover, Adesanya’s fight against Romero was heavily criticized for the lack of action in the fight. The fight was slammed by the UFC boss, Dana White himself. Also, White admitted the matchmakers thought it was a bad idea too.
